Analysis

The package spectral-corsair@999.999.1000 is a dependency-confusion stub (version 999.999.1000) that executes install.js on install/postinstall. It searches for CTF flag values in files (/flag, /root/flag, /tmp/flag, ./flag), environment variables (FLAG, FLAG_HTB, HTB_FLAG), and /proc/self/environ, then exfiltrates any captured flag to the C2 host 94[.]237[.]48[.]51:46517 via HTTP PUT to /api/modules/ECT-987654 and HTTP GET to /api/debug?flag=... It also writes the flag to disk at /tmp/spectral_corsair_flag.txt, /tmp/flag.txt, ./flag.txt, and /var/tmp/flag.txt, and outputs it to stdout/stderr for log capture. When no flag is found, it lists the root directory contents for reconnaissance.
